WebbWhat is the largest and smallest county in England? As of 2009, the largest county by area is North Yorkshire and the smallest is the City of London. The smallest county with multiple districts is Tyne and Wear and the smallest non-metropolitan county with a county council is Buckinghamshire. WebbRutland is the smallest county in England with a total area of 382 sq km (147.4 sq miles). Sandwiched in between Leicestershire, Lincolnshire, Cambridgeshire, and Northamptonshire, it’s totally landlocked. The only towns in Rutland are Oakham, the county town, and Uppingham.
